Write on the Edge wins Psychologically Healthy Workplace Award

The California Psychological Association has awarded Write on the Edge, Inc. (WOTE), the 2004 Psychologically Healthy Workplace Award "for the company's creative and innovative practices in ensuring the health and well-being of its workforce."

WOTE President and STC San Diego Past President Suzanne Hosie said, "I think this award illustrates our level of commitment to providing our employees with a healthy workplace, both physically and mentally."

According to the California Psychological Association, the benefits of a healthy workplace can include increased productivity and employee retention rates, recruiting advantages, company image enhancement, and a better workplace atmosphere. And failure to provide a psychologically healthy workplace can impact the bottom line.

Among the programs that WOTE has used to foster a psychologically healthy workplace are:

  • flexible work schedules for employees


  • company sponsorship of work-related classes and programs


  • annual sponsorship of employees to regional and national STC conferences


  • an extensive orientation program for new employees


  • a variety of social events for employees
